What I Look For Before Buying
Before I buy a battery operated sensor light, I always check a few important things. First, I look at the sensor range and how quickly it detects movement. I also pay attention to the brightness level because I want enough light without it being too harsh. Battery life matters a lot to me too, since I prefer lights that do not need frequent battery changes. I also consider whether the light has adjustable settings, such as auto-on duration or sensitivity control.
Brightness and Light Quality
In my experience, brightness is one of the most important features. I usually check the lumens to understand how bright the light will be. For small spaces like closets, a softer light is often enough, but for stairways or dark corners, I prefer something brighter. I also like lights with a warm white or neutral white tone because they feel more comfortable to my eyes.
Battery Life and Power Efficiency
Battery life is something I never ignore. A good sensor light should last a long time, especially if it is going to be used often. I usually look for models that use LED technology because they tend to save power. Some lights also have an auto shut-off feature, which I find very helpful because it prevents unnecessary battery drain.
Installation and Placement
One thing I appreciate most about these lights is how easy they are to install. I prefer lights that come with adhesive strips, magnets, or simple screw mounts. Depending on where I want to use them, I make sure the installation method suits the surface. I also think carefully about placement so the sensor can detect motion properly and the light covers the area I need.
Sensor Range and Sensitivity
For me, the sensor is what makes these lights truly useful. I look for a model with a good detection range so it turns on before I reach the area. At the same time, I do not want it to trigger too easily from every little movement. Adjustable sensitivity is a feature I find very useful because it lets me control how the light behaves in different spaces.
Indoor vs. Outdoor Use
I always check whether the light is meant for indoor or outdoor use. Indoor battery operated sensor lights are great for hallways, wardrobes, and cabinets. If I want one for outdoor use, I make sure it is weather-resistant and durable enough to handle moisture or temperature changes. I would never assume a light is suitable for outdoors unless the product clearly says so.
Extra Features I Find Helpful
Some features make a battery operated sensor light even better in my opinion. I like models with multiple lighting modes, dimming options, or manual on/off controls. A rechargeable battery option can also be a big plus for me because it reduces waste and saves money over time. If the light has a sleek design, that is an added bonus since I prefer something that blends well with my space.
